Handover note: the Forgelet test-data factory library underpins nearly every integration suite at Quillhaven. Factories are registered in `registry.py`; keep definitions deterministic, as several suites assert on generated values. The sequence counters reset per test session — changing that will break the Ordway billing tests in subtle ways. Document any new trait carefully. Ongoing stewardship questions should be addressed to the maintainer of record, named below.

named custodian: Ulaix Wenwyn

**Ticket #  — staging env misconfigured for ws compression**

Hey new folks, welcome to the fun. Staging has `WS_COMPRESSION=always`, which tanks CPU on the Bramble relay whenever the dashboard floods small frames — compression only pays off above ~1KB payloads. Prod correctly uses `threshold` mode. Someone copied the wrong template again.

Fix: set `WS_COMPRESSION=threshold` and `WS_COMPRESS_MIN_BYTES=1024` in staging's `.env`. While you're in there, the relay also needs its handshake secret re-added, on the line right after this one.

vault entry, yahif-yajep: COURIER_KEY29=b802bdf8034096b65a51c6ba5abe2

**Building Access — Lost Badge Procedure**

If you lose your badge at Quillhaven Point, report it to the security office on the ground floor as soon as possible so it can be deactivated. You will be issued a temporary paper pass valid for 48 hours. During that window, the stairwell doors and the third-floor lab corridor will not read the paper pass; instead, use the keypad code below.

door code, yagap-bahof: bdg-O-05

# Limits & Quotas: Sweepling Bot

Quick reference for the eng sync. Sweepling prunes stale branches across the Hollowpine org, but it's deliberately throttled so we never hammer the git backend or surprise anyone mid-release. It skips protected branches, batches deletions, and backs off when the API gets grumpy. If you want to argue about the numbers, bring it to sync — current values are below.

tuning table, faduf-baduf:
PRIORITIES = {
    "ulavan": 191,
    "silys": 750,
    "goriel": 238,
    "kelmir": 66,
    "wendor": 432,
}